Proenergia Summit 2022 has as its central theme the energy transition

Expectation of 2 thousand participants and will address the most modern in the sector

A 4th edition of Proenergia Summit 2022 will take place at the Ceará Events Center, in Fortaleza (CE) and will bring together important names in the energy sector. The event will be held on the 21st and 22nd of September and will have as its central theme: transition in energy and market news.

The event is being organized by the Union of Energy and Services Industries of the Electrical Sector of the State of Ceará (Sindienergia-CE), and will feature relevant names from the sector, such as: Adolfo Sachsida, Minister of Mines and Energy; Ronaldo Koloszuk, president of Absolar; Eduardo Ricotta, president of Vestas; and Armando Abreu, president of Qair.

According to the union, in addition to having an exclusive space for rounds in business – promoted by the Secretariat of Economic Development and Labor (SEDET) – will also offer the public present speeches It is exhibitions with the main companies and players in the axis.

“All possible paths today in the energy sector lead to the energy transition. The decarbonization process has been experienced with great intensity throughout the world, in favor of the use of clean and renewable energy. Therefore, this will be the macro theme that will guide the Proenergia Summit 2022”, said Luis Carlos Queiroz, president of Sindienergia-CE.

According to the organizers, the event will address issues such as: green hydrogen, decarbonization of processes, urban mobility, sustainable cities, public policies, energy transport, regulations, offshore wind, solar photovoltaics, biogas, investments in the energy sector, among others.
